Definition of municipality noun from the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ary

municipality

noun
 
/mjuːˌnɪsɪˈpæləti/
 
/mjuːˌnɪsɪˈpæləti/
(plural municipalities)
(formal)
jump to other results
  1. a town, city or district with its own local government; the group of officials who govern it
    • The municipality provides services such as electricity, water and rubbish collection.
    Topics Politicsc2
    Word Originlate 18th cent.: from French municipalité, from municipal from Latin municipalis (from municipium ‘free city’, from municeps, municip- ‘citizen with privileges’, from munia ‘civic offices’) + capere ‘take’.
